what is an equation of the line that passes through the point (3,-8) and has a slope of -2

Answer:

y = -2x - 2

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

m = -2

Slope-intercept:

y - y1 = m(x - x1)

y + 8 = -2(x - 3)

y + 8 = -2x + 6

y = -2x - 2
